BERETTA WINS LARGEST U.S. MILITARY HANDGUN CONTRACT SINCE WORLD WAR II ALL PISTOLS TO BE BUILT BY U.S. WORKERS IN MARYLAND GARDONE VALTROMPIA (January, 2009) - Beretta announced that the US subsidiary Beretta U.S.A. Corp. has been awarded with with a U.S. Army contract to provide up to 450,000 Beretta Model 92FS pistols to U.S. military customers. The total value of the contract, if all pistol quantities and associated spare parts are ordered, is $220 million. Delivery of pistols against the contract has already begun. "We are honored to see the quality and performance of the Beretta Model 92FS pistol continue to be acknowledged in this dramatic way," commented Cav. Ugo Gussalli Beretta, President of Beretta U.S.A. "It is clear that the Beretta 9mm pistol still sets the standard for military users throughout the world." "This contract will help ensure jobs for hundreds of U.S. workers in the Beretta U.S.A. factory in Maryland for years to come" added Cav. Ugo Gussalli Beretta. "Beretta U.S.A. was awarded the contract to provide the Beretta 9mm Model 92FS pistol as the standard sidearm for the U.S. Armed Forces back in 1985 and we have continued to do so on a constant basis ever since." |
